Java開(kāi)篇七:開(kāi)發(fā)工具篇
張:你有什么開(kāi)發(fā)工具推薦嘛?
李:很多好東西呀.............
01
工具
首先我分為四個(gè)部分:


有需要領(lǐng)取的小伙伴,請(qǐng)?jiān)谖业墓娞?hào)回復(fù):“工具”? 就可以領(lǐng)取這圖片了。
以上的工具一般的開(kāi)發(fā)任務(wù)都可以滿足需求了,以后有什么好的東西我也會(huì)陸續(xù)的分享給大家,希望這篇文章可以幫助到大家!
01
idea的基本設(shè)置
1、文件修改變動(dòng):
git文件修改后,默認(rèn)只有當(dāng)前文件更改而父文件沒(méi)有標(biāo)注,很不直觀;查了一頓后,發(fā)現(xiàn),可以設(shè)置;
File—->settings—->version control—–>勾選show directories with changed descendants?

解決tomcat中文亂碼問(wèn)題
JAVA_TOOL_OPTIONS -Dfile.encoding=UTF-8


IDEA統(tǒng)一編輯文件編碼
全局編碼設(shè)置
File -> Other Settings -> Default Settings
Editor -> File Encodings

當(dāng)idea中properties配置文件中文顯示utf8編碼亂碼
file->setting->editor->file encodings
把transparent native-to-ascll conversion勾選上就行了。

解決IDEA中tomcat啟動(dòng)控制臺(tái)亂碼問(wèn)題。
菜單欄run- Edit Configurations 或 右上角有個(gè)向下的小箭頭?
選擇你亂碼的tomcat -> service->VM option,配置虛擬機(jī)編碼格式為UTF-8(-Dfile.encoding=UTF-8)

配置Maven

配置tomcat容器

設(shè)置統(tǒng)一編譯器和編譯版本

設(shè)置類注釋文件

/**
* @Package ${PACKAGE_NAME}
* @author 侯文遠(yuǎn)
* @date ${DATE} ${TIME}
* @version V1.0
* @Copyright ? 2016-2017 奧琦瑋信息科技(北京)有限公司
*/

設(shè)置方法注釋
先創(chuàng)建一個(gè)自定義快捷鍵,輸入如下內(nèi)容:(第一行不要加*號(hào),因?yàn)槟阍谝焉闪斜砝锸怯械臅r(shí)候他前面已經(jīng)存在一個(gè)*號(hào)了。)
@author 侯文遠(yuǎn)
* @date $date$ $time$

使用步奏:
1)在方法的上部輸入/**+enter
2)填入相關(guān)信息
3)在最尾部輸入自定義快捷鍵,我的是@aut+tab
效果圖:

IDEA忽略某個(gè)文件或者文件夾,如系統(tǒng)的.idea文件夾和.iml文件。

以上差不多就是idea的常用設(shè)置了吧
01
vscode插件

View In Browser

vscode-icons
改變編輯器里面的文件圖標(biāo)
Bracket Pair Colorizer
給嵌套的各種括號(hào)加上不同的顏色。
Auto Rename Tag
自動(dòng)修改匹配的 HTML 標(biāo)簽。

Path Intellisense
智能路徑提示,可以在你輸入文件路徑時(shí)智能提示。

stylelint
CSS / SCSS / Less 語(yǔ)法檢查
Prettier
比Beautify更好用的代碼格式化插件
Vue插件
vetur
語(yǔ)法高亮、智能感知、Emmet等
GitLens
詳細(xì)的 Git 提交日志。
Git 重度使用者必備,尤其是多人協(xié)作時(shí):哪一行代碼,何時(shí)、何人提交都有記錄。
css-auto-prefix
自動(dòng)添加 CSS 私有前綴。
CSS Peek
定位 CSS 類名。
以上就是vscode的常規(guī)插件,希望可以幫助到各位朋友!
? ? ? ? ? ? ? ? ??
